Mr. Gerrish afterward became largely interested in various Muskegon Mills, part owner of the Saginaw Bay & Northwestern logging Railroad, and prior to his death May 19th, 1882, was probably the largest individual logger in the world, his highest annual contribution to Muskegon River being 130,000,000 feet in 1879. The maps presented here are a selection from the Geography and Map Division holdings, based on the popular cartobibliography, Railroad Maps of the United States: A Selective Annotated Bibliography of Original 19th-century Maps in the Geography and Map Division of the Library of Congress, compiled by Andrew M. Modelski (Washington: Library of Congress, 1975). Transportation was a major expense lumbermen encountered when Railroads are the lifeblood for North America's freight transportation. There are in the collections of the Library of Congress thousands of American railroad maps as well as numerous general maps showing railroad routes as part of the transportation network.
